Code

Rating   Name Duplication Size Complexity Changes Bugs Features
F DeferBackend\DeferBackend::includeInHTML() 0 74 30 10 3 1
C DeferBackend\DeferBackend::javascript() 0 22 13 8 0 1
B DeferBackend\CspProvider::addCspHeaders() 0 22 7 2 0 1
B CspProvider::addSecurityHeaders() 0 9 7 2 0 1
B DeferBackend::themedJavascript() 0 15 7 4 0 0
A DeferBackend\DeferBackend::replaceBackend() 0 14 6 2 0 0
A DeferBackendTest::testWrapScripts() 0 14 1 3 1 0
A DeferBackend\DeferBackend::getCSS() 0 9 4 2 1 0
A CspProvider::get_template_global_variables() 0 2 1 1 0 0
A DeferBackendTest::testWriteToHeader() 0 2 1 1 0 0
A DeferBackendTest::testProvideTemplate() 0 1 1 1 0 0
A DeferBackend\CspProvider::getCspNonce() 0 3 2 1 0 0
A Test\DeferBackendTest::testNonce() 0 1 1 1 0 0
A DeferBackend\DeferBackend::getDeferBackend() 0 4 2 1 0 0
A DeferBackend\CspProvider::setCspNonce() 0 1 1 1 0 0